On 1/30/24 09:57, Andreas Rheinhardt wrote:
>
> Please don't rely on the type of jxl_fmt.align here (which is out of our
> control). E.g. in the future it may be that libjxl supports only 32bit
> align values (i.e. uses uint32_t or so for it), but that we support
> 64bit (ptrdiff_t) linesizes and allocations, so that jxl_fmt.align *
> (info.ysize - 1) may overflow this even when -linesize fits into
> jxl_fmt.align.
> (Very unlikely given that align is size_t and they will likely not go
> back from this, but it could happen.)
>
This would be an ABI break though, wouldn't it? Why do we need to work
around a potential future ABI break?
